Checkmate Dedication
December 9, 2006

 

Checkmate was dedicated on a beautiful December day.

Bob Lowry, representing the Public Art Committee, was the master of ceremonies.

Karen Oxman represented the Golden City Council and thanked the Civic Foundation and the Rotary Club for the financial support that enabled Golden to acquire this piece.

The sculptor, Herb Mignery, discussed the meaning and structure of the piece.

Herb described the process of using an older, seasoned horse to train a young horse.

Rotary President Bob Short, scuptor Herb Mignery, and Golden Civic Foundation Vice President Dave Powers.  It was Bob who originally spotted the piece in a hotel in Houston and arranged for Golden to acquire it.  The Rotary Club and Golden Civic Foundation both provided financial support for the acquisition.
